Distinguish between Shares and Debentures.

Answer»
 Shares Debentures
 Shareholders are the owners of the company Debenture holders are the creditors of the company
 Shareholders get dividends Debenture holders get interest
 Shareholders have voting right Debenture holders have no voting right
 No security is required to issue shares Generally debentures are secured
 Shares are not redeemable Debentures are redeemable
 Share capital is payable after paying all outside liabilities Debenture holders have the priority of repayment over shareholders
